John Harden is a scholar working on Electronic, Optical and Magnetic Materials, Mechanical Engineering and Molecular Biology. According to data from OpenAlex, John Harden has authored 17 papers receiving a total of 649 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Electronic, Optical and Magnetic Materials, 5 papers in Mechanical Engineering and 4 papers in Molecular Biology. Recurrent topics in John Harden’s work include Liquid Crystal Research Advancements (8 papers), Advanced Materials and Mechanics (5 papers) and Electrospun Nanofibers in Biomedical Applications (3 papers). John Harden is often cited by papers focused on Liquid Crystal Research Advancements (8 papers), Advanced Materials and Mechanics (5 papers) and Electrospun Nanofibers in Biomedical Applications (3 papers). John Harden collaborates with scholars based in United States, Hungary and Japan. John Harden's co-authors include Antal Jákli, Samuel Sprunt, J. T. Gleeson, Katalin Fodor‐Csorba, Nándor Éber, Badel L. Mbanga, Quan Li, Martin Chambers, Paul Luchette and Rafael Verduzco and has published in prestigious journals such as Physical Review Letters, Applied Physics Letters and Journal of Materials Chemistry.
